What Makes This Cotton Different
These squares are woven from 100% pure cotton that's never been chemically treated, bleached, or dyed - and it's certified organic in Japan. You can genuinely feel the difference the first time you use one: thick, soft, and none of that synthetic-fiber roughness you get from drugstore cotton rounds.
How I Use Them
My routine is simple: saturate a pad with Koh Gen Do's Spa Cleansing Water and sweep away makeup, or soak one in lotion and use it as an impromptu sheet mask over problem areas. The thickness means one pad does the job that would take two or three flimsy ones elsewhere.
Pros
Pros: genuinely organic and chemical-free, thick enough to double as a mini sheet mask, gentle on sensitive and reactive skin, doesn't shed fibers.
Cons
Cons: pricier than mass-market cotton pads, 80-count bag goes fast if you use it daily for both cleansing and toning.
